Table of Contents

Methodology and metaphysics; identity and contradiction; subject and predicate; terms and relations; space and time; idealism and the absolute; the absolute and its appearances; system and scepticism.

Reviews

`Mander's new book ... contributes to the rebirth of Bradley's thought ... Mander's book has its strong points. He provides a rigorous defence of Bradley's arguments ... a meticulous analysis of the anti-relational arguments ... a welcome contribution to Bradley scholarship ... the book will be valued mainly for clarifying and accessing the various interpretations of Bradley and for providing a basis for contemporary treatment of Bradleian themes.' Mind
